Fig. 5: Effects of homotypic repeat sequences and nucleotide skew on J2 binding.
From: Structural basis of double-stranded RNA recognition by the J2 monoclonal antibody

a Sequences of dsRNA, dsDNA, RNA-DNA hybrids, ssRNA, and ssDNA of repetitive sequences (40 bp or 40 nts) used in J2 IgG binding analyses. b Representative BLI sensorgrams (top, at 400 mM KCl), temperature-scanning CD spectra (middle) and unfolding transitions (lower) of duplex nucleic acids in (a) binding to J2 IgG. Different shades of blue indicate temperature transitions from 20 °C (dark blue) to 97 °C (light blue). c Representative BLI sensorgrams (top, at 400 mM KCl) and temperature-scanning CD spectra (bottom) of single-stranded nucleic acids in (a) binding to J2 IgG. d Comparison of the CD spectra of nucleic acids in (b, c) at 20 °C. e Melting temperatures of duplex nucleic acids in (a) derived from temperature-scanning CD data in (b).
